inspire2coach International

inspire2coach has worked on a number of courses and projects around the world in English and French:

  • working on projects with the ITF and Tennis Europe
  • training coaches
  • advising national associations
  • writing coaching resources
  • presenting at national and international conferences
  • Training tutors from East Africa in Nairobi, Kenya for ITF (2008)
    Training Egyptian coaches in Mini Tennis, Cairo, Egypt
    (2008, 2009, 2010)
    Designing programmes for the Palm Aroussy Tennis
    Academy, Cairo, Egypt (2009, 2010)

    Team mentoring programme for David Lloyd clubs in
    Spain, Holland, Ireland and Belgium (2009, 2010)

    Tennis Europe tutors course for top coaches from Southern
    and Eastern Europe in Rotterdam, Netherlands (2009)
    ITF/CAT West and Central African Coaches Workshop in Dakar, Senegal (2009)
    Hellenic Tennis Federation Coaches Workshop in Athens, Greece (2009)

    ITF Tennis 10s workshops for Tennis Emirates (2010)

     

    Tennis 10's
    In 2009, the ITF launched Tennis 10's. From 2012, the ITF aims to introduce a rule that will mean that no under 10 age group competition can take place using a standard yellow ball. Instead a slower red, orange or green ball must be used.
    inspire2coach has worked closely with the ITF and Tennis Europe on this hugely significant project.
